Top Guide to Choosing Winning Dropshipping Products
Finding the winning dropshipping product can seem like a tough task. With so many choices out there, it's simple to get lost in the crowd. But don't fret, with a little investigation and a keen eye for patterns, you can find a product that's sure to boom.
Here are some crucial factors to analyze when choosing your next dropshipping prize:
* **Demand:** Look for products with high demand. Use tools like Google Trends and Amazon Best Sellers to measure the current market climate.
* **Competition:** Analyze the intensity of competition for your chosen product. While some competition is normal, you want to avoid a oversaturated market.
* **Profit Margins:** Target for products with healthy profit margins. Consider both the expense of goods and the shipping costs.
* **Shipping Time:** Customers dropshipping yaptim value fast shipping. Choose products that can be shipped quickly to minimize customer dissatisfaction.
* **Product Quality:** Don't neglect product quality. Offer items that are durable, well-made, and satisfy customer expectations.
